The Automotive Fleet & Leasing Association (AFLA) announced on July 28 that four members were recently elected and appointed to serve on their board.

 -
Matthew Betz, expert-fleet optimization at DTE Energy, will serve as secretary. Caroline Costello, vice president, business development for Auto Driveaway, will fill the position of director of allied service providers. “AFLA has always been a cornerstone in my fleet career – providing valuable resources and connections for learning and growing in our industry," said Costello. "I'm honored to be re-elected and thankful for the chance to ensure AFLA continues providing robust learning and development opportunities for our member base."

Don Wright, commercial sales director at Five Star Ford, will hold the office of director of dealers on the AFLA board. Debbie Struna was re-elected to serve a second term as director of remarketers. Struna is currently national account manager at Fleet Street Remarketing, LLC. AFLA’s new leaders will officially begin their terms at the close of the AFLA 2021 Corporate Fleet Conference, themed Emerging Stronger, held October 3-6, 2021 in San Antonio, Texas, at the La Cantera Resort & Spa.
